1883 – Matlock Bath Pavilion & Gardens, Derbyshire

Architect: J. Nutall

0011

The Matlock Bath pavilion was completed around 1884. Also known as the Palais Royal, it wasan ambitious structure with a 228ft frontage of mainly glass. For many years it had a resident orchestra and the main stage drew stars such as Sarah Bernhardt. It was replaced in 1910 by the current pavilion.
